U.S. Navys Bureau of Medicine and Surgery Standardizes on eRoom Solution For Global Collaborative InitiativesDigital Workplace Enables BUMED to Proactively Manage Medical Services Through Collaboration with Colleagues Around the Globe Cambridge, Mass., March 4, 2002 - eRoom Technology, Inc., a leading provider of digital workplaces for extended enterprise collaboration, announced today that the U.S. Navy’s Bureau of Medicine and Surgery (BUMED) has standardized on the eRoom® solution for its collaboration and integration requirements. Managing the medical needs of more than 2.6 million people, located on land and at sea in a wide range of combat and peacetime conditions, is a monumental task for Navy Medicine. BUMED has deployed the eRoom digital workplace solution to create a globally accessible collaborative environment for sharing information, ideas, knowledge and expertise among its senior staff members. Available on an around-the-clock basis, the eRoom solution enables BUMED personnel to track, manage and collaborate on documents and projects, engage in ongoing discussions, as well as streamline the processes that drive its services. From project and budget planning to pre-deployment exercises, the eRoom solution provides the virtual work environment for BUMED to unite its resources around the globe, enhancing organizational productivity and effectiveness. “Whether staff members are at home or abroad, decisions must be made and projects moved forward,” said VADM Michael L. Cowan, surgeon general of the U.S. Navy. “Yet the complexities of staying on top of your business when people are constantly on the move are significant.” The eRoom solution provides worldwide accessibility, low total-cost-of-ownership and open access to the applications and systems that support BUMED services. “One of the greatest challenges global organizations face is how to bring together three key areas - the work, the team and the workplace - in such a way as to create real strategic value,” said Jeffrey Beir, president and chief executive officer for eRoom Technology, Inc. “As a company, we have faced this challenge head-on, delivering state-of-the-art collaborative solutions to the world’s most demanding customers.
